What is Aerial Yoga?

Aerial yoga is a unique fitness practice that combines traditional yoga postures, pilates, and dance with the use of a suspended fabric hammock. This innovative approach allows participants to perform poses that are often challenging on the ground. The hammock provides support, enabling practitioners to deepen stretches, alleviate joint pressure, and enhance alignment.

Typically practiced in a class setting, aerial yoga classes cater to various skill levels, from beginners to advanced yogis. Instructors guide participants through sequences that incorporate both strength and flexibility, promoting body awareness and coordination. The hammock can also assist in inversion poses, allowing practitioners to experience the benefits of gravity-assisted stretching.

One of the key advantages of aerial yoga is its ability to reduce stress and improve mental clarity. The gentle suspension encourages relaxation and a sense of weightlessness, making it an excellent choice for those looking to enhance mindfulness. Additionally, the practice can be beneficial for strengthening core muscles, improving posture, and increasing overall body strength.

Before joining an aerial yoga class, it is important to inform the instructor of any pre-existing health conditions. With proper guidance and practice, aerial yoga can be a fun and effective way to enhance physical and mental well-being.
